    O2 enjoys strongest ever start to a trading year

    Tracy WestBy Tracy WestMarch 1, 20242 Mins Read
    LinkedIn Facebook Twitter Email
    Share
    Facebook Twitter LinkedIn Email

    The Entertainment District and Outlet Shopping at The O2, which are owned and operated by Waterfront Limited Partnership, a joint venture between AEG and Crosstree Real Estate Partners, have experienced their strongest start to a trading year with stellar results throughout January and February, including half-term, resulting in the destination expecting to top 2023’s record-breaking year of results.

    The O2  welcomed over 1.5 million visitors between January 1 and February 25, marking a 46% increase compared to the same period last year. Hand-in-hand with the rise of visitors, The O2 also experienced a 25% increase in sales compared to 2023, with average weekly sales having increased by 18%. More specifically, Outlet Shopping at The O2 saw an uplift of 18% in sales versus the same period in 2023, bolstered by the sample sales of Hackett and Scamp & Dude. The Entertainment District also recorded stellar results, with a 30% rise in sales compared to 2023.

    February half-term (February 12 – 25) was exceptionally robust, with Outlet Shopping at The O2 recording a strong sales uplift of 54% and average transaction value uplift of 13% compared to the same period in 2023. Similarly, the Entertainment District experienced an impressive sales increase of 29% and rise in average transaction value by 5% versus 2023, coinciding with the destination reaching full leasing completion.

    Across the whole scheme The O2 welcomed a 45% rise in footfall and 37% rise in sales during the half-term weeks compared to 2023. Sales across specific categories also increased, with ‘Grab and Go’ F&B, Homeware, and Leisure seeing an uplift of 109%, 40%, and 34% respectively compared to the same period last year.

    Janine Constantin-Russell, managing director of the Entertainment District and Outlet Shopping at The O2, said: “Following such strong results in 2023, we are delighted to be celebrating such a positive start to 2024. We continue to be the destination of choice when it comes to retail, leisure, and F&B, and these results emphasise the role we play in delivering a successful and desirable offer for our visitors, with everything under one roof. 2024 has already showcased a significant moment for the destination with the Entertainment District reaching full leasing completion, and we look forward to replicating more milestones throughout the rest of the year.”
